What is a From Home AVR programmer?

A from home AVR programmer is a professional who develops, tests, and updates firmware for AVR microcontrollers remotely, often using programming tools and software. This role typically requires knowledge of embedded systems, programming languages like C or Assembly, and remote collaboration skills.

Job description

Description
Our electric power generation clients are seeking to increase the power output of their existing power plants to meet the electric demands. This is expanding work in the nuclear industry. You will work on major systems, equipment and plant process in the following areas:
  • Perform consulting level work for power uprates in the nuclear industry.
  • Interface with clients and project teams to present technical discussions and project status.
  • Develop engineering proposals and cost estimates.
  • Manage resources/resource loading and develop estimates for task completion and budget development.
  • Review calculations related to heat balances, power train pumps, heat exchangers, condenser/heat sink, and plant hazards to support client recommendations and reviews.
  • Review task reports and equipment evaluations that present technical information in a clear and concise manner to meet client requirements.
  • Review equipment sizing, optimization evaluation, and selection in response to client needs to support the proposed power uprate.
  • Evaluate vendor bids from a technical perspective.
  • Interface with vendors to perform document reviews, ensure equipment compliance with specifications and needs of the plant.
  • Lead and mentor junior engineering staff on power plant engineering technical tasks.
  • Perform independent reviews of work performed by others including calculations and drawing preparation.
  • Attend client meetings and site walkdowns to validate scope and ensure client satisfaction.

This role offers a hybrid work arrangement. You'll spend three days a week in the office, giving you the flexibility to work remotely for two days.
Qualifications
We do not sponsor employees for work authorization in the U.S. for this position.
Essential skills and experience:
  • This position requires a BSME from an ABET Engineering Accreditation Commission-approved program with a strong academic background and interest in thermodynamics, heat transfer, and fluid mechanics.
  • 15+ years of experience in the nuclear power industry.
  • Experience with nuclear power uprates and/or turbine retrofit projects.
  • Experience and practical knowledge in one or more of the following areas:
    • Power Uprates (EPU/SPU/MUR)
    • Power Uprate pinch point assessments and/or task reports
    • Turbine / Generator / AVR / Exciter Refurbishments
    • Heat Exchanger Replacement (FWH/MSR/TFP)
    • Isophase Bus Duct
    • Transformer/Switchyard
    • NSSS Systems
    • Licensing Application
  • All assignments require the preparation of calculations and/or reports, and excellent technical report writing skills are essential.
  • Knowledge of the practical application of mechanical engineering and technology including applying systems, principles, techniques, procedures, and equipment to a project design.
  • Strong interest in numerical computations and problem solving.
  • Working knowledge of codes, standards, and regulations that apply to mechanical engineering design of nuclear power plants.
  • Proficiency with MS Office applications.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

About Sargent & Lundy

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Sargent & Lundy is one of the most experienced full-service architect-engineering firms in the world. Founded in 1891, the firm is a global leader in power and energy with expertise in grid modernization, renewable energy, energy storage, nuclear power, and fossil fuels. Sargent & Lundy delivers comprehensive project services--from consulting, design and implementation to construction management, commissioning and operations/maintenance--with an emphasis on quality and safety. The firm serves public and private sector clients in the power and energy, gas distribution, industrial, and government sectors.
